Abstract :
Reusable packaging has been with the magnet wire industry for 30 years. It has primarily been limited to plastic spools and reels. What had been very apparent over the years is that loss and damage to those reels has been very high. With a large customer base, knowing if the reels and spools have come back has been impossible. Many manual systems have been tried and have failed. The nature of the recovery procedures, in that full trucks have been necessary to keep the return cost down, necessitated that reels and spools from different customers had to be mixed in the trucks. This made defining who they came back from with a manual system impossible. In recent years, bar coding has become a solid technology. Over the last two years, the author´s company have looked at the millions of dollars they have spent on new reels and spools and worked on a new tracking system. They have come up with what the author considers the best-in-class tracking system utilizing the present labels that they apply to the spools and reels. This paper presents an outline of that system
